SZ["Ztunnel"] end Client--Plain-->CZ CZ-."HBONE (target)".->Server CZ--"HBONE (actual)"-->SZ SZ--Plain-->Server ``` ### Pooling User connections can be multiplexed over shared HBONE connections. This is done through standard HTTP/2 pooling. The pooling is keyed off the `{source identity, destination identity, destination ip}`. ### Headers

As noted already, programmers are strongly encouraged to use appropriate synchronization to avoid data races. In the absence of data races, Go programs behave as if all the goroutines were multiplexed onto a single processor. This property is sometimes referred to as DRF-SC: data-race-free programs execute in a sequentially consistent manner. </p> <p> While programmers should write Go programs without data races,
